Undated photo of heart surgeon Dr. Christiaan Barnard who made the world's first heart transplant at the Groote Schuur Hospital in Cape Town, where Barnard put the heart of road accident victim Denise Darvall into the chest of 55-year-old Louis Washkansky. Washkansky lived for 18 days before his body rejected the heart. Barnard performed the operation on December 3,1967. The South African heart transplant pioneer Barnard died in Paphos, Cyprus, on Saturday September 1, 2001, in a hotel room. Barnard was 78. (KEYSTONE/AP Photo/Str) === ===
